P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a source code check program which is suitable for the characteristic of a COBOL language and is high in error detection accuracy. SOLUTION: The COBOL source code check program 110 searches a syntax tree with a data item having a plurality of items as a start point, and compares a conditional statement of the data item with table size definition. By searching a syntax with the data item as a start point, unauthorized table access processing can be detected beforehand with the size of the data item as a reference. COPYRIGHT: (C)2011,JPO&INPIT

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a money receipt processing program coping with the difference of data formats used by a paying side and a billing side while processing a collective money receipt item as separate money receipt. SOLUTION: The money receipt processing program divides collective money receipt data into separate money receipt items using detailed breakdown data. When performing the division, the program uses a format master defining the correspondence between items describing the collective money receipt data and items describing the detailed breakdown data and performs the division with correlating and matching both the items.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ide an ID management program which flexibly manages a state of a user ID.SOLUTION: A new state of "scheduled deletion" is introduced as the state of the user ID. A manager or the like of an ID management server carries out ID deletion work, and instructs the purport thereof to the ID management program. The ID management program receives an assignment about the user ID to be deleted, and determines the propriety of effectiveness as to the assigned user ID. The ID management program determines whether the "scheduled deletion" is assigned in a life cycle of the user ID instructed to be deleted or not, when the user ID is effective. The state of the user ID instructed to be deleted is changed to the "scheduled deletion", when the "scheduled deletion" is assigned, and the purport thereof is recorded in a user ID file. An ID set to a "scheduled deletion" state gets impossible temporarily to be used at this point, and is deleted physically at the time point when a prescribed expiration time lapses.

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ide an XML document distribution system and an XML document distribution method, capable of reducing a transferred data volume, without impairing comfortable service enjoyed by a user. SOLUTION: The XML document distribution system 1 includes an XML document distribution server 100 capable of distributing an XML document via a network 300, and a reception terminal 200 capable of receiving the XML document. The XML document distribution server 100 includes a compiler 110 for preparing a compile-finished XML document 11, by converting a specified character sequence of a tag or the like included in the XML document 10, into a specified code such as a control code. The reception terminal 200 includes a compile-finished XML parser 210 of elucidating the compile-finished XML document 11 received via the network 300, and of acquiring a data included in the compile-finished XML document 11.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a grammar checking method of HTML data, enabling efficient development of a web application. SOLUTION: A proxy server has a grammar checking function of HTML data. If there is no grammatical error in the HTML data, the proxy server transmits the HTML data from a web server to a client computer as it is. If there is a grammatical error, the proxy server generates data for displaying the source of the HTML data and transmits message data corresponding to the grammatical error to the client computer.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ain a mechanism for generating a short-term schedule of an operating instruction level as a production flow chart without imposing any burden on a worksite. SOLUTION: This program for making a computer generate the production flow chart of a product is configured to make the computer execute: an extraction step for extracting manufacture instruction information from a database in which manufacture instruction information to instruct the manufacturing operation of a product is stored; and a conversion step for converting the manufacture instruction information into tabular form data. The extraction step includes making the computer extract the start date and end date of the manufacturing process of the product as manufacture instruction information, and the conversion step includes making the computer record information showing a line or an arrow using a start date and end date as a start point and an end point in tabular form data.
